Feel the impact from heavy snow winds. more than 2,000 flights were canceled or delayed today in the u.s. are only going to get worse. we ve got a team of reporters covering these monster storms and where they re heading. barry pedersen leads off us in denver. barry, how are things in the mile-high city? reporter: the conditions are getting a little better, but because of the storm, hundreds of miles of interstate were closed in colorado, kansas, wyoming, and nebraska. and that s a preview of what s coming from this storm. here in denver, a night and a day of snow meant a nightmare of people going nowhere, or worse, trying to drive in whiteout conditions, and that didn t always end well. accidents littered the highways as drivers tried to navigate the slick roads, some better than others. our cbs news team stopped to help one woman who ran off the road tonight. it s not just the snow. ....

of two american military officers today by an unknown gunman. the officers were shot in the heavily guarded interior ministry in kabul, while in kunduz to the northeast, three people died in a violent protest outside a u.n. compound. it is all part of the turmoil since u.s. troops inadvertently burned copies of the koran earlier this week. mandy clark is in kabul. reporter: the shooting erupted at the command-and- control center inside afghanistan s ministry of interior. it should have been the most secure location in the building. sources told cbs news that the two american officers, a colonel and a major, were shot in the head with a pistol at close range. witnesses heard three shots. a colleague ran to the command center, finding the two dead. the gunman had disappeared. there are reports he was an afghan officer who had earlier argued with the americans. later, the taliban claimed responsibility, saying one of its members had infiltrated the ministry. general john ....
